General Motors stated it expects to obtain $500 million in refunds from tariffs that have been ruled unlawful by the Supreme Court in February – however its board lately debated whether or not the company ought to even apply for a refund, The Post has discovered.

Last week, President Trump stated he would “remember” firms that didn’t apply for a tariff refund, which sources stated has given some huge companies pause after the federal authorities final week opened a portal to permit firms to use to get tariff money back.

The Supreme Court ruled in February that the International Emergency Economic Powers Act didn’t give President Donald Trump the ability to unilaterally impose tariffs.

Given the high court docket’s ruling, one legal professional who requested to not be recognized stated firms that choose out of making use of for a refund may risk shareholder lawsuits for strolling away from money that they’re owed.

Last week, there have been media studies that Amazon and Apple had determined to not apply for a tariff refund, however the firms haven’t publicly disclosed whether or not they are going to or gained’t apply for a tariff refund, a source advised The Post.

Amazon is reporting earnings on Wednesday may tackle the state of affairs for the primary time, the source stated.

In GM’s case, the company’s tariff publicity is far bigger than the refund it expects to obtain this 12 months from Uncle Sam.

The automaker stated on Tuesday during an earnings call that its whole tariff publicity – together with tariffs on imported automobiles, components and elements beneath Section 232 – is now $2.5 billion to $3.5 billion, or $500 million much less than its earlier estimate.

The anticipated tariff refund boosted the Detroit auto maker’s outlook for 2026. REUTERS

Accordingly, GM is now boosting its full-year revenue forecast by $500 million, GM CEO Mary Barra stated in a letter to shareholders because the company introduced its first-quarter outcomes. Barra additionally cited sturdy gross sales of its full-size pickup vehicles, regardless of rising gasoline costs.

GM is an unlikely goal of the president’s ire over refunds, one source stated, noting how a lot it has invested in growing its US manufacturing capabilities.

For the primary quarter of 2026, GM reported earnings of $2.63 billion and income of $43.62 billion. REUTERS

Over the previous 12 months, the Detroit company has invested $5.5 billion to ramp up its US manufacturing, together with six factories in Michigan, Kansas, Tennessee, Ohio and New York.

There are more than 330,000 importers who paid the IEEPA tariffs that have been invalidated, totaling $166 billion.

The IEEPA tariffs alone price the everyday American family $700 final 12 months, in line with the nonpartisan Tax Foundation.
